History

The company was founded in 2012 by Chuck Mumford, who began by modifying military surplus ballistic sunglasses (made in the early 1990s) and reselling them under the brand 'Pit Viper', based on a nickname he earned while skiing. He soon partnered with Chris Garcin to produce stickers for the glasses, and they began creating an online storefront and perfected the social media marketing approach for which they would become known.
